不同外源添加物对牛粪厌氧发酵的影响

摘    要:为探索不同外源添加物对牛粪厌氧发酵的影响,在以牛粪为原料的厌氧发酵过程中,向厌氧生物反应器中分别添加尿素、草木灰和铁粉,研究在(20±1)℃条件下各添加物对厌氧发酵产沼气的影响,分析厌氧发酵过程中日产气量、累积产气量、pH、氨态氮质量浓度及碱度的变化。结果表明,在牛粪中添加5g草木灰的累积产气量及产气速率最大,3种添加物对牛粪累积产气量的影响强弱顺序为草木灰>铁粉>尿素;添加3种添加物后pH波动较小,都在适宜范围内;氨态氮质量浓度除草木灰组有所升高外,其他两组均降低;碱度的变化中,尿素组升高,草木灰和铁粉组的波动较小且比较稳定。

Influences of Different Extraneous Source Supplements on Cow Dung Anaerobic Fermentation

Abstract:In order to explore different extraneous additives on anaerobic fermentation of cow dung,the commensurability urea,the plant ash and the powdered iron were separately added into the biogas reactor in the condition of(20±1) ℃,and the daily methane production,the accumulation of methane,the pH,the ammoniacal nitrogen mass concentration and the alkalinity change were analyzed.The test result indicated: the accumulation of methane and gas production rate reached the highest point when 5 g plant ashes were added in;the effects of three supplements on gas accumulation were ordered as plant ash > powdered iron>urea;the effects of three supplements on the pH value were lower;the ammoniacal nitrogen content was increased in plant ash treatment,and decreased in other two treatments;the alkalinity was stable in the plant ash and the powdered iron treatments,increased in urea treatment.
